logo

Output 51c8ba6ab602baa9b3cd26e7aa35de0c2818dc7b3a885fe24ec23f16002c755d:1

value
1075187623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49750da508ba475f18929fa5cea21ff8aac20e58 OP_EQUALVERIFY OP_CHECKSIG
address
17hQZ1Ynceg3UmQ7e5ZxUXhMNr1uDiXHrW
transaction
51c8ba6ab602baa9b3cd26e7aa35de0c2818dc7b3a885fe24ec23f16002c755d